Bank of Baroda SO Recruitment 2018-19 : Check Official Notification
Bank of Baroda (BOB) has finally declared the recruitment notification for the post of job profile Specialist Officers (SO). Bank has released the 913 vacancy of specialist officers (SO) in Scale I, II, III in disciplines of Legal, Wealth Management Service – Sales & Wealth Management Services – Operations.
Candidates will be recruited based on three selection processes – (i) Bank of Baroda SO Online Test
(ii) Group Discussion (GD)/ Personal Interview (PI)/ Psychometric Test.

Bank of Baroda SO Vacancy 2018-19
Post Name | No. of Vacancy | Pay Scale |
Legal MMG/ Scale-III | 20 | Rs. 42020 × 1310 (5) – 48570 × 1460 (2) – 51490 |
Legal MMG/ Scale-II | 40 | Rs. 31705 × 1145 (1) – 32850 × 1310 (10) – 45950 |
Wealth Management Service – Sales MMG/ Scale-II | 150 | Rs. 31705 x 1145 (1) – 32850 x 1310(10) – 45950 |
Wealth Management Service – Operations MMG/ Scale-II | 700 | Rs. 31705 x 1145 (1) – 32850 x 1310(10) – 45950 |
Wealth Management Services – Sales JMG/ Scale-I | 01 | Rs. 23700 x 980 (7) – 30560 x 1145(2) – 32850 x 1310(7) – 42020 |
Wealth Management Services – Operations JMG/ Scale-I | 02 | Rs. 23700 x 980 (7) – 30560 x 1145(2) – 32850 x 1310(7) – 42020 |
Bank of Baroda SO Eligibility Criteria – Educational Qualification & Age Limit
Post Name | Education Qualification | Age Limit |
Legal Officer MMG/S-III | Bachelor Degree in Law and minimum 5 years of experience as Law Officer in Legal Dept | 28 to 35 Years |
Legal Officer MMG/S-II | Bachelor Degree in Law and minimum 3 years of experience as Law Officer in Legal Dept | 25 to 32 Years |
Wealth Management Services – Sales MMG/S-II | 2 Year (MBA or equivalent) Post Graduation Degree or Diploma with specialisation in Marketing / Sales / Retail. (The Institute should be approved by Govt / Govt Bodies / AICTE) OR Graduation (recognized / approved by Govt., Govt. bodies / AICTE) with One year Diploma/ Certification in Banking / Finance before joining any private Bank/ Public Bank. 4 years of experience in Sales / Distribution of Wealth / Mutual Fund / Insurance Products in Banks, Mutual Funds, NBFC’s etc | 25 to 35 Years |
Wealth Management Services – Sales JMG/S-I | Graduation in any stream and 2 years of experience in Sales / Distribution of Wealth / Mutual Fund / Insurance Products in Banks, Mutual Funds, NBFC’s etc | 21 to 30 Years |
Wealth Management Services – Operations MMG/S-II | 2 Year (MBA or equivalent) Post Graduation Degree or Diploma with specialisation in Marketing / Sales / Retail / Finance and 5 years of experience in working on Wealth Management Solutions. | 21 to 35 Years |
Wealth Management Services – Operations JMG/S-I | 2 Year (MBA or equivalent) Post Graduation Degree or Diploma with specialisation in Marketing / Sales / Retail/Finance and 3 years work experience in working on Wealth Management Solutions for processing Wealth Products / Mutual Fund / Insurance Applications etc | 21 to 30 Years |
Bank of Baroda SO Age Relaxation
Category | Age Relaxation |
SC/ST | 5 Yrs |
OBC – Non Creamy Layer | 3 Yrs |
PwD | 10 Yrs |
Ex Servicemen, Commissioned Officer | 5 Yrs |
Persons ordinarily domiciled in the State of Jammu & Kashmir during the period 1 Jan 1980 to 31st Dec 1989 | 5 Yrs |
Persons affected by 1984 riots | 5 Yrs |

Bank of Baroda SO Online Test Negative Marking
There will be penalty for wrong answers marked in the Objective Tests. For each question for which a wrong answer has been given by the candidate, one fourth or 0.25 of the marks assigned to that question will be deducted as penalty to arrive at corrected score. If a question is left blank, i.e. no answer is given by the candidate; there will be no penalty for that question.

Bank of Baroda SO Document Verification
The following documents in original together with a self attested photocopy in support of the candidate’s eligibility and identity are to be invariably submitted at the time of interview failing which the candidate may not be permitted to appear for the interview.
i. Printout of the valid GD/ Interview Call Letter.
ii. Valid system generated printout of the online application form.
iii. Proof of Date of Birth (Birth Certificate issued by the Competent Municipal Authority or SSLC/ Std. X Certificate with DOB).
iv. Photo Identify Proof.
v. Caste Certificate issued by competent authority.
vi. An Ex-serviceman candidate has to produce a copy of the Serivce or Discharge Book.
vii. “No Objection Certificate” from their employer at the time of interview.
viii. Persons eligible for age relaxation under 1.2 (5) must produce the domicile certificate at the time of interview.
ix. Any other relevant documents in support of eligibility, etc.
